JD (U) condole Joumol catastrophe

Janata Dal (United) has expressed its grief over the loss of 20 lives in yesterday’s landslide at Chandel district.
Speaking to media person, president of JD (U) Manipur unit, N Tombi said that personnel of national disaster response team has already arrived at Joumol village of Chandel while the state disaster response force is yet to be at the affected site.
Instead of visiting the site the government should take remedial and relief measures to ensure safety of the people, said the president.
He also urged the state government and concerned departments to provide all possible assistance to victims’ families and affected people. He said those affected should be compensated.
He appealed the state health department, PHED, CAF and PD to go hand in hand as people will need their help at the moment.
